    VeriFinder™ S100 RIID

    Compact Gamma & Neutron Radiation Identifier

    The VeriFinder™ S100 from Symetrica redefines portable radiation detection with a sleek, lightweight, and ergonomically engineered design that delivers without compromise. Built for field operators, this compact Radio-isotope Identification Device (RIID) combines advanced hardware, industry-leading algorithms, and Symetrica’s innovative Discovery Technology® to ensure rapid, accurate detection of gamma and neutron sources—even when masked or shielded.

    Equipped with Symetrica’s cutting-edge detectors, the VeriFinder S100 delivers real-time feedback and isotope classification through a color-coded interface. It also supports seamless data transmission to centralized monitoring systems, enabling quick decision-making in critical situations.

    From border security and emergency response to military and nuclear facility protection, the VeriFinder S100 offers precision, durability, and operational confidence in a small, mission-ready package.

    Specifications

    VeriFinder™ S100 Specification

    Mission

    Search, locate, identify, and verify radioactive threats.

    Technology

    Radioisotope Identification Device (RID)

    Model

    VeriFinder™ S100

    Standard Configuration

    S100-1N2 (Part # 400-0160)

    Performance

    • Identification: Exceeds ANSI N42.34
    • Gamma Detector Type: NaI(Tl)
    • Detector Volume: 43 cm³ (2.6 in³)
    • Effective Resolution: 2.2% FWHM at 662 keV (¹³⁷Cs)
    • Raw Resolution: <8% FWHM at 662 keV (¹³⁷Cs)
    • Energy Range (Gamma): 25 keV – 3 MeV
    • Performance: Class-leading ‘Minimum Identifiable Amount’ (MIA)¹ using patented algorithms
    • Maximum Dose for ID: 1 mSv/h (100 mrem/h)
    • Dose Rate Measurement: 10 nSv/h to 900 mSv/h (1 µrem/h to 90 rem/h)
    • Response Time: Instant response (0.2 s) with continuous operation through temperature shock using 1 GHz CPU
    • Time to ID from Power Up: Up to 90 seconds
    • Sampling Time: User settable from a few seconds to 60 minutes
    • Health Status Monitoring: Automatic and continuous end-to-end digital calibration and health monitoring

    Neutron

    • Detector Type: Li⁶F/ZnS
    • Detector Size: 2.7 cm dia. × 11 cm (1″ dia. × 4.3″)
    • Capability: ²⁵²Cf 20,000 n/s @ 0.6 m/s @ 0.25 m (2 ft/s @ 10 in)
    • Energy Range: 0.025 eV to 15 MeV

    Compliance

    • Specifications: ANSI N42.34, ANSI N42.42, IEC 62327, IEC 62755
    • Ingress Protection: IP67 (IEC 60529)
    • Radiation Safety: Dosimeter / Mission Dose modes
    • Gamma Dose Accuracy: ±10% for ¹³⁷Cs
    • Inbuilt neutron moderator for handheld use enables ALARP (As Low As Reasonably Practicable) – Neutron model

    Mechanical

    • Dimensions: 29.2 × 11.8 × 11 cm (11.5 × 4.6 × 4.3 in)
    • Weight: 1.3 kg (2.9 lbs)

    Electrical

    • Battery: Integrated Li-ion
    • Run Time: 14 hours
    • Communications: Bluetooth, WiFi, USB-C
    • Display: 3.5 in. (8.9 cm)
    • Operational Temperature: -20°C to 50°C (-4°F to 122°F)
